Bon Jovi re-releases their classic studio albums as "Special Editions." Each of the band's first 10 albums--Bon Jovi, 7800° Fahrenheit, Slippery When Wet, New Jersey, Keep The Faith, These Days, Crush, Bounce, Have A Nice Day and Lost Highway- will feature the original studio album tracks plus era-specific live recordings included as bonus tracks. The bonus live tracks include songs taken from sound checks and concerts held in venues from all over the world, ranging from 500-seat theatres to massive football stadiums. Each "Special Edition" collection features new packaging, including images from each period, and new liner notes documenting the band's success through each stage of their twenty-five year career, as well as reproductions of laminated tour credentials. Additionally, each "Special Edition" will provide fans with the ability to gain "backstage access" to The Bon Jovi Virtual Tour Experience -- a website being created to offer exclusive virtual content, including photos, tour memorabilia and additional live audio tracks.

"I agree that this "new" re releases are just a waste of money, so save it!

I would imagine that only collectors would like to buy them, because most fans have previous versions already, but what's new with these ones? Nothing! It would be still worth it if the live tracks were never previously released, something really new, but why spend more money to have the Wanted (album version) and Wanted (live)?

They entice fans with the "vault" content, but... inside are pictures and one more song, that you can listen to, but if you want it, you have to pay more. Each CD has the key to a different one, so if you want to see what else is there, you have to buy ALL the CDs. Money making idea at it's best!



If someone is interested in real "new" content, I totally recommend the Box Set (100 million fans can't be wrong), released in 2004, with 4 CDs (rare and never before released tracks) and 1 DVD.



One more detail, there seem to be 2 different types of packaging offered with these CDs, a hard cardboard cover and the usual plastic cases. The advertised backstage passes ONLY come with the cardboard ones, (more expensive in price I believe), so... Beware.
